How Remote Work Can Protect Women: Balancing Career and Personal Life

Remote work has become a crucial tool for women seeking to balance their careers and personal lives. With the flexibility to work from anywhere, women can manage their time more effectively, ensuring they meet both professional and family responsibilities. However, recent trends suggest that many companies are planning to crack down on remote work, which could have significant implications for women and other groups who benefit from flexible work arrangements.

Benefits of Remote Work for Women

– **Flexibility**: Remote work allows women to manage their schedules around family commitments, such as childcare and eldercare, which can be challenging in traditional office settings.
– **Career Advancement**: By having more control over their work environment, women can focus on career development without the constraints of commuting or office distractions.
– **Work-Life Balance**: Remote work helps women achieve a better balance between work and personal life, leading to increased job satisfaction and reduced stress.

Challenges and Concerns

Despite these benefits, there are concerns about the future of remote work. A recent survey indicates that 70% of employers plan to enforce stricter return-to-office policies, which could disproportionately affect women and other groups who rely on remote work for career advancement and personal well-being. This shift could lead to a discriminatory divide, where those who can return to the office are favored for promotions and raises, potentially hindering the career progress of remote workers.
